New leadership for technical design and production

Shaminda Amarakoon ’12MFA has been appointed chair of the technical design and production department and director of production at Yale School of Drama/Yale Repertory Theatre, for a three-year term effective July 1. He succeeds Bronislaw (Ben) Sammler ’74MFA, the Henry McCormick Professor Adjunct of Technical Design and Production, who will step down June 30 from his duties as chair (which he has held since 1980) and head of production. Sammler will continue on the faculty part time, teaching Structural Design for the Stage, and will also consult on plans for a new facility to house both the School of Drama and Yale Rep.

Works selected for 2017 Institute for Music Theatre

The Yale Institute for Music Theatre, under the artistic direction of Mark Brokaw ’86MFA, has selected two original book musicals for this year’s two-week summer lab: Cowboy Bob, created by Molly Beach Murphy, Jeanna Phillips, and Annie Tippe, with book by Molly Beach Murphy and music and lyrics by Jeanna Phillips; and Gumbo, music by Brett Macias and book and lyrics by Christina Quintana. The 2017 Institute, which runs June 10–25 at Yale School of Drama, will culminate with open rehearsal readings of each project, presented as part of the annual International Festival of Arts & Ideas, on June 23 and 24. In addition, Gordon Leary and Julia Meinwald, authors of Pregnancy Pact, which was developed in the 2011 edition of the Institute, are returning this year to work on their musical REB + VoDKa + ME as this year’s Alumni Residents.
